Transaction 52c2269614e813ba24f62625ecab9e6793db13aac04dc9d5397017c99035dd05
1 Input
1 Output
-
52c2269614e813ba24f62625ecab9e6793db13aac04dc9d5397017c99035dd05:0
- value
- 767538
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72bb02c34fe04b5e5ecb510fd0fe94404724f5be OP_EQUAL
- address
- 3C9ez9fB8RA7aeFZNxnACiDYuh1uApdHXD